Linguistica Brunensia is an open-access peer-reviewed scientific journal published since 2009 by Masaryk University in Brno. The journal focuses on general linguistics and publishes articles on key topics related to the structure and use of natural language. It focuses on research based on formal approaches to natural language analysis as well as on descriptions of language phenomena. Both synchronic and diachronic studies from all linguistic subdisciplines are published. Due to the tradition of the journal, we prefer studies based on (i) research on specific languages, especially Slavic languages (with emphasis on Czech), and (ii) studies examining specific languages in a broader typological and the historical-comparative perspective.
